CI Troubleshooting: Bounce Processor Flakes

If the Mistvale bounce-processor suite fails on the parse stage, check whether the fixture mailbox container started before the worker; a race there produces empty batches and a misleading timeout. Restarting the job usually clears it, but if failures persist across three runs, the DNS stub is likely stale—rebuild the test network. Do not mute the suite; bounce classification regressions have shipped that way before. When escalating, include the pipeline run's identifying token, shown below.

pipeline stamp: htk31_f769b577b3028a4e9958e5bb8d1259a

## Local Setup

Grandiff is a diff viewer tuned for files over 500 MB. Clone the repo, install dependencies with the bundled script, and start the chunking daemon before launching the UI. Diff metadata and chunk indexes are stored in Postgres, so you need a local instance running. Seed it with the sample fixtures, then set your environment to the connection string below.

replica DSN, tajep-hagug: mysql://novath_svc:CR@db-85cb.torvaforge.example:5432/prair

- [ ] **Step 7: Breaker override escrow.** After sealing the signing keys for the Tallgrove upstream API circuit breaker, confirm the support team can force the breaker open during a full outage. The override bundle lives in the sealed escrow drawer and is useless without its unlock phrase. Two ceremony witnesses must initial this step before proceeding. The escrow bundle is decrypted with the recovery passphrase that follows.

vault phrase of kahip-kahop = holath-quenmir

MatchCore, Quillard's candidate matching service, runs on a JVM with a generational collector and occasionally hits multi-second GC pauses under heavy indexing. Pauses over two seconds trip the latency alarm and can block a release. Before promoting a build, check the GC dashboard for the prior 24 hours. If pause times look abnormal, hold the release and contact the runtime team below.

billing contact of kagaf-bahif = fraox_ralvan_tamwyn@zemvarcloud.local